I am trying to create a spreadsheet with a button control that will "show
all" lines once the user has finished using a line selected by using a
filter.
I know how to add a button, I know how to record a macro, I just can't
figure out how to run the macro when the button control is clicked. Any
Help?

When you add a button from Forms toolbar into worksheet, you are asked for
assigning the macro attached to this button.
 
If you have created the macro and placed the button on the sheet you
should be able to assign a macro by right clicking the button and use
'Assign a Macro' from the drop down menu.
